HTML <script> referrerpolicy Attribut

❮ HTML <a> tag

Exemple

Définissez la referrerpolicy pour un script :

<script src="myscripts.js" referrerpolicy="origin"></script>

Définition et Utilisation

L'attribut referrerpolicy spécifie quelles informations de référent doivent être envoyées lors de la récupération d'un script.


Support des Navigateurs

Les chiffres dans le tableau indiquent la première version du navigateur qui prend entièrement en charge l'attribut.

Attribut
referrerpolicy 70.0 79.0 65.0 Non Oui

Syntaxe

<script referrerpolicy="no-referrer|no-referrer-when-downgrade|origin|origin-when-cross-origin|same-origin|strict-origin-when-cross-origin|unsafe-url">

Valeurs d'Attribut

Valeur Description
no-referrer Aucune information de référent n'est envoyée
no-referrer-when-downgrade Par défaut. Envoie l'origine, le chemin et la chaîne de requête si le niveau de sécurité du protocole reste le même ou est plus élevé (HTTP à HTTP, HTTPS à HTTPS, HTTP à HTTPS est acceptable). N'envoie rien à un niveau moins sécurisé (HTTPS à HTTP n'est pas acceptable)
origin Envoie l'origine (schéma, hôte et port) du document
origin-when-cross-origin Envoie l'origine du document pour une requête inter-origine. Envoie l'origine, le chemin et la chaîne de requête pour une requête de même origine
same-origin Envoie un référent pour une requête de même origine. N'envoie aucun référent pour une requête inter-origine
strict-origin-when-cross-origin Envoie l'origine si le niveau de sécurité du protocole reste le même ou est plus élevé (HTTP à HTTP, HTTPS à HTTPS, et HTTP à HTTPS est acceptable). N'envoie rien à un niveau moins sécurisé (HTTPS à HTTP)
unsafe-url Envoie l'origine, le chemin et la chaîne de requête (indépendamment de la sécurité). Utilisez cette valeur avec précaution !

❮ HTML <a> tag